TOPLUS® Triethylene Glycol Monobutyl Ether (TB), also known as Butoxytriglycol, is a high-boiling-point, hydrophilic glycol ether characterized by its low volatility, excellent water solubility, and strong coupling ability. As a member of the ethylene oxide-based "E-series" glycol ethers with an extended chain length, it provides unique performance in applications requiring prolonged solvent action, effective coupling of water with polar and non-polar compounds, and enhanced penetration.
The primary value of TB lies in its combination of high boiling point, low vapor pressure, and significant hydrophilicity. Its key applications include serving as a vital coupling agent and solvent in water-based industrial and institutional cleaning formulations, where it effectively bridges water with oils, greases, and hydrophobic functional additives. It is also an important component in water-based coatings, inks, and dye formulations to improve stability and performance. Furthermore, TB is utilized as a key ingredient in hydraulic and brake fluids due to its lubricity and moisture-absorbing properties, and finds specialized use as a penetrant and carrier solvent in agrochemicals and textile processing aids.
